substack just rug pulled all of their customers

the creator economy’s promise is taking power from institutions and giving it to individuals

but substack has now become the institution

they're extracting value from creators and trying to lock them into their platform for good Image last week they announced that all writers are required to offer Apple's in-app purchase (IAP) payment option

that does two things

1) increases the cost to readers by 30%
2) locks writers into the platform long-term

we analyzed over 15 BILLION emails so you don't have to

here are my top 5 takeaways from the @beehiiv 2025 state of newsletters report 👇 Image 🕓 timing is everything

· peak engagement occurs in the mornings
· best open rates occur tuesday - thursday
· lowest open rates on saturdays Image
